Lake Worth ISD board adopts resolution to defease or redeem unlimited tax bonds

The Lake Worth ISD Board of Trustees adopted a resolution directing the defeasance and/or redemption of certain outstanding unlimited tax bonds at the Aug. 28 special meeting. Trustee Cristina Gallagher moved for adoption; Trustee Bret Tooke seconded, and the motion passed 7–0.
The resolution appoints an authorized officer and delegates to that officer the authority to make determinations required to effectuate any defeasance or redemption and enacts related provisions. The minutes record the motion and unanimous approval but do not list the specific bond series, amounts, or timing for defeasance/redemption.
